Resident Evil Village is an upcoming survival horror video game developed and published by Capcom. It will be the tenth major instalment in the Resident Evil series, and the sequel to Resident Evil 7: Biohazard.

  7. Her design seems to be partially based on1900s pictures of babies with their mothers hidden in the background. The mother or hired woman at the photography studio had to put a cloth or a blanket over herself while holding the baby, so it wouldn't move too much while the baby's solo picture was being taken.Also her last name Beneviento is a reference to the Italian legend of the Witches of Benevento.
